An American Airlines regional jet collided with a U.S. Army Black Hawk helicopter on Jan. 29. Both aircraft plunged into the Potomac River near Reagan Airport.

Two Metropolitan Washington Airports Authority employees have been arrested after a leaked video showing the deadly midair collision between a military helicopter and a commercial jet surfaced online.
